As a long-time resident of Toronto, I am opposed to many elements of Bill 60. specifically how it will make roads more dangerous and will worsen traffic congestion.
The Bill bans any reduction of motor vehicle lanes, with wording so broad that it will not just impact bike lanes as it targets, but also affect bus priority lanes, patios, school streets, and other street improvements that rely on reallocating space.
The government’s own experts have consistently said that bike lanes are not a cause of gridlock. Blocking new protected bike lanes will risk accidents serious injuries and deaths for people biking, walking, and driving.
It also strips cities of local authority and decision-making in areas where they have the most knowledge, even when projects are supported by evidence and local residents.
Ontarians want evidence-based transportation planning and local democracy. Bill 60 should be scrapped and the provincial government return to consulting with local municipalities on their needs instead of trying to dictate to them.
